About Kavitha Srinivas
Kavitha Srinivas is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Information Systems, Cognitive Neuroscience, Computer Networks and Communications and Management Science and Operations Research, having authored 91 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Semantic Web and Ontologies (26 papers), Software Engineering Research (14 papers), Data Quality and Management (13 papers), Topic Modeling (12 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(11 papers), Memory Processes and Influences (11 papers), Neural and Behavioral Psychology Studies (9 papers) and Advanced Database Systems and Queries (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(974 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(476 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(288 citations), Artificial Intelligence (540 citations) and Software (44 citations). Kavitha Srinivas has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Chile and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Henry L. Roediger, Anthony J. Greene, Randolph D. Easton, Anastasios Kementsietsidis, Octavian Udrea, Suparna Rajaram, John Schwoebel, Julian Dolby, Shelly Dews and Ellen Winner.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Experimental Psychology Learning Memory and Cognition, Memory & Cognition, Proceedings of the VLDB Endowment, Journal of Memory and Language and Psychonomic Bulletin & Review.
